How to Create a Digital Art Collection

Creating a digital art collection is an exciting endeavor that allows you to explore and appreciate various forms of digital art from around the world. With the rise of digital art platforms and the increasing accessibility of digital art tools, it has become easier than ever to build a collection that reflects your personal taste and interests. In this article, we will guide you through the process of creating a digital art collection, from identifying your preferences to curating and showcasing your collection.

1. Define Your Interests and Preferences

The first step in creating a digital art collection is to define your interests and preferences. Consider the following questions to help you narrow down your focus:

– What type of digital art do you enjoy? (e.g., pixel art, vector art, 3D modeling, digital painting)
– Are there any specific themes or subjects that you are drawn to? (e.g., nature, abstract, futuristic)
– Do you prefer a particular style or technique? (e.g., hyperrealism, minimalism, surrealism)

Answering these questions will help you identify the types of digital art that you want to include in your collection.

2. Explore Digital Art Platforms

Once you have a clear idea of what you are looking for, it’s time to explore digital art platforms. There are numerous websites and online communities where you can discover and purchase digital art. Some popular platforms include:

– DeviantArt
– ArtStation
– Society6
– Etsy
– Behance

These platforms offer a wide range of digital art, from free-to-use images to high-quality prints and merchandise.

3. Build Your Collection

Start by searching for digital art that resonates with your interests. As you come across pieces that you like, consider the following factors to determine if they are a good fit for your collection:

– Quality: Ensure that the art is of high resolution and meets your standards for quality.
– Originality: Look for unique and creative pieces that stand out from the crowd.
– Relevance: Make sure that the art aligns with your interests and preferences.

When you find a piece that you want to add to your collection, save it to a folder or use a digital art management tool to keep track of your acquisitions.

4. Curate Your Collection

As your collection grows, it’s essential to curate it thoughtfully. This involves organizing your digital art into categories, such as themes, styles, or mediums. Some tips for curating your collection include:

– Create a cohesive theme: Choose a unifying theme or subject that ties your collection together.
– Balance your collection: Aim for a diverse range of art pieces to keep your collection engaging and interesting.
– Rotate your display: Change the layout of your collection periodically to keep things fresh and exciting.

5. Showcase Your Collection

Finally, showcase your digital art collection to share your passion with others. Here are some ways to display your collection:

– Create a digital art gallery on your website or social media platform.
– Print and frame your favorite pieces to display in your home or office.
– Collaborate with other digital artists to create a collective art exhibit.

By following these steps, you can create a digital art collection that not only reflects your personal style but also provides you with a source of inspiration and enjoyment. Happy collecting!
